The Sonata for Flute & Piano by Jonathan Slade (494-03284) is an exquisite composition that showcases the beautiful interplay between the flute and piano. This piece is an ideal choice for both skilled musicians and educators, bringing a captivating blend of melodies and harmonies. Composed with a deep understanding of both instruments, this sonata allows performers to explore various techniques and expressions, making it perfect for concerts or as part of a music curriculum.
